EPL: Sanchez Late Penalty Fires Arsenal To 4th

Alexis Sanchez scored his fourth goal of the season as the Chilean converted a last-gasp penalty to give Arsenal a 1-0 victory over Burnley at Turf Moor.

Aaron Ramsey was pushed down by defender James Tarkowski in injury time and Sanchez smashed home the resulting spot-kick to move the Gunners up to fourth in the table ahead of Liverpool and Tottenham.

It was a repeat of last season’s meeting between the sides at the Emirates Stadium, when Chilean Sanchez slotted in a 98th-minute spot-kick to win the game. It was also the third consecutive time that the Gunners had grabbed a winner in stoppage-time against the Clarets.

Burnley have now lost just two Premier League games all season.

In the other game of the afternoon, Southampton handed struggling Everton a heavy defeat at Saint Mary’s.

Charlie Austin scored two second-half headers, while Dusan Tadic and Steven Davis were also on target to give the home side a 4-1 victory over the Toffees.
